What Is a Dark Spot Corrector?
No doubt you already have an idea of what a dark spot corrector is. But just in case, let me break it down.
Dark spot correctors are skincare treatments designed to fade hyperpigmentation—whether it’s from sun damage, acne scars, or aging.
You wouldn’t think there’d be so many variations, but there are. Some work faster than others, some are gentler, and the key ingredients can vary a lot. My go-to choices always have Vitamin C, niacinamide, or alpha arbutin—powerful ingredients known for brightening skin and evening out tone.
How to Use a Dark Spot Corrector
Dark spot correctors are most effective when used consistently—but knowing how to use them properly is key.
✅ Apply to clean, dry skin before moisturizer.
✅ Use only on affected areas unless the formula is gentle enough for full-face application.
✅ Pair with sunscreen during the day—many brightening ingredients make skin more sensitive to sunlight.
✅ Be patient—most dark spot correctors take a few weeks to show visible results.

What to Think About When Buying a Dark Spot Corrector
With so many options available, choosing the right dark spot corrector can be tricky. Let me break down the most important factors to consider.
Key Ingredients
When I first started using dark spot correctors, I assumed they all worked the same. Wrong! The effectiveness really depends on the ingredients.
🔹 Vitamin C – A must-have for brightening and evening skin tone.
🔹 Niacinamide – Helps with discoloration and strengthens the skin barrier.
🔹 Alpha Arbutin – A gentler alternative to hydroquinone for fading dark spots.
🔹 Neoglucosamine – Exfoliates and improves skin texture while boosting brightness.
If you want fast results, look for products that combine multiple brightening ingredients.
Skin Type Compatibility
Not all dark spot correctors are suitable for every skin type.
🔹 Sensitive Skin? Opt for gentle formulas with niacinamide or alpha arbutin.
🔹 Oily Skin? Lightweight, non-greasy serums work best.
🔹 Dry Skin? Look for hydrating formulas with added moisturizers.
The last thing you want is a corrector that irritates your skin or clogs pores.
Application & Texture
Dark spot correctors come in different forms—serums, lotions, even cleansers. The choice depends on how you like to use your skincare.
🔹 Serums – Fast-absorbing and highly concentrated.
🔹 Lotions/Creams – Better for dry skin, often more hydrating.
🔹 Cleansers – Good for mild discoloration but won’t be as powerful as leave-on treatments.
If you want targeted treatment, serums are usually the best bet. But if you’re looking for an all-over brightening effect, a lotion or cleanser can be a great addition to your routine.

Care & Storage
One of the biggest mistakes people make with dark spot correctors? Not storing them properly.
Here’s what to do:
✅ Keep it in a cool, dark place – Many brightening ingredients (especially Vitamin C) break down with light exposure.
✅ Close the lid tightly – Oxygen can degrade some active ingredients over time.
✅ Check expiration dates – Using an old corrector might not give you the results you’re looking for.
Taking proper care of your corrector ensures maximum effectiveness and longer shelf life.

Frequently Asked Questions
Do dark spot correctors really work?
Yes! But the key is consistent use and choosing the right ingredients for your skin type.
How long does it take to see results?
It depends on the product, but most correctors show visible results in 4-8 weeks with daily use.
Can I use a dark spot corrector every day?
Yes, most dark spot correctors are designed for daily use, but always follow the product’s instructions. Some stronger formulas (like those with retinol) may be best used a few times a week.
Should I use sunscreen with a dark spot corrector?
Absolutely! Sunscreen is a must when using dark spot correctors. If you don’t protect your skin from UV exposure, new dark spots can form, and existing ones may take longer to fade.
Can I use multiple dark spot correctors at once?
Not always a good idea. Too many active ingredients at once can irritate your skin. If you want to layer treatments, start slow and test how your skin reacts.
